About the role:

The Project Manager oversees our residential pool renovation projects from concept to completion. The Project Manager is a natural leader with a passion for construction, a keen eye for detail, and an unwavering commitment to customer satisfaction. They will be the central point of contact for clients, crews, and vendors, ensuring every project is completed on time, within budget, and to our high-quality standards.


What you'll do:

  •  Project Planning & Scheduling: Develop comprehensive project timelines, coordinate crew schedules (demolition, plumbing, tile, plaster, etc.), and ensure the timely ordering and delivery of all materials and equipment. 
  • Client Communication: Serve as the primary point of contact for homeowners. Conduct initial site meetings, provide regular progress updates, answer questions, and manage client expectations throughout the entire remodeling process.      
  • On-Site Supervision: Actively manage and supervise on-site construction activities.Ensure all work, including tile, coping, plaster, and equipment installation is performed correctly, safely, and according to the project plans.
  • Budget Management: Monitor project costs, track expenses, and manage the budget to ensure profitability. Approve subcontractor and vendor invoices.      
  • Quality Control: Conduct regular site inspections to guarantee workmanship meets our company's high standards and industry best practices. Create and manage punch lists to ensure a flawless final product.
  • Team & Vendor Coordination: Liaise with and manage in-house crews, subcontractors, and suppliers. Foster positive working relationships to ensure seamless project execution.
  • Problem Solving: Proactively identify and resolve any on-site issues, challenges, or delays that may arise, minimizing impact on the project timeline and budget. 
  • Permitting & Compliance: Coordinate with local municipalities to ensure all necessary permits are secured and that all final inspections are passed successfully.
  • Change Orders: Discuss, develop and get signed approval from customers on change orders for items that may change or be added to an existing project or contract.


What we are looking for:

  •  To effectively perform the duties for this position, individuals must be able to demonstrate competencies that are essential to the position, which include:   
  • 3–5 years of experience in project management or field operations within construction, trades, or home/outdoor services.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ple concurrent projects and lead cross-functional teams.
  • Strong commun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ills.
  • Working knowledge of scheduling, budgeting, and estimating practices.
  • Proficiency in project management software and field operations systems.
  • Understanding of OSHA and general job-site safety requirements.
  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el between project sites as needed.
  • Being bilingual (English/Spanish) is a significant plus.


Physical Requirements/Work Environment: 

  • Regularly visits active job sites and outdoor environments.
  • Involves standing, walking, climbing, and lifting up to 50 lbs. as needed.
  • Requires use of PPE and adherence to all safety standards.
  • Occasional office work for scheduling, reporting, and coordination.
  • Travel between projects within the assigned market is required.
